Operation Definition
Putting in a nonbiological appliance that monitors, assists, performs, or prevents a physiological function but does not physically take the place of a body part
Procedure Overview
This family covers procedures that place a device into one of the veins of the upper body - the arms, neck, chest, or head - without replacing any part of the vein itself. The most common example is placement of a central venous catheter, port, or PICC line into a vessel such as the subclavian, internal jugular, axillary, or basilic vein. These devices stay in the vein to give medications, draw blood repeatedly, deliver chemotherapy or long-term antibiotics, or provide dialysis access, sparing a patient from having a new needle stick every time care is needed.
A clinician chooses this approach when a patient needs reliable, repeated venous access over days, weeks, or months, or when medications are too irritating for a standard peripheral IV. Placement is usually done with ultrasound guidance and confirmed by X-ray to ensure the tip sits in the right location before use begins.
Because the device remains in place after the procedure ends, follow-up visits for flushing, dressing changes, or eventual removal are a separate, related encounter rather than part of this same code.
Anatomy & Axis Detail
Hand Vein, Right
The hand veins on the right side form a superficial dorsal network draining the fingers and back of the hand into the larger forearm veins, and their visibility and accessibility make them the most common site for routine short peripheral intravenous catheter placement, used for medication administration, fluid therapy, and blood draws. Because these veins are small, thin-walled, and mobile under the skin, insertion requires careful stabilization and a smaller-gauge device compared with more proximal arm veins, and they are generally reserved for short-term rather than long-term access due to a higher risk of infiltration and phlebitis with prolonged use. Insertion at this site means a catheter or needle-based device is placed into the vein's lumen without cutting or excising tissue. Because hand veins are so frequently accessed, documentation should confirm the right-hand location distinct from forearm or other upper-extremity sites.
Approach: Open
Open approach means the surgeon cuts through skin, mucous membrane, or other tissue layers to physically expose the target site to view before performing the procedure. It gives direct visualization and hands-on access, distinguishing it from Percutaneous approaches where instruments pass through a small puncture without exposing the site. Open is typical for procedures needing wide access, such as most laparotomies.
Device: Infusion Device
Infusion Device denotes a device left in place to deliver medication, fluids, or other substances into a body part over time, such as an intrathecal or epidural pump. It is distinct from devices that merely monitor or mechanically support tissue, since its function is ongoing pharmacologic or fluid delivery rather than structural replacement. Common placements include the spinal canal, peritoneal cavity, and vascular access sites.
Coding & Documentation
Coders assign an Insertion code here when documentation describes a device left in the body after the procedure - a catheter, port reservoir, or similar hardware - rather than a temporary tool used and withdrawn. The operative note should identify the specific upper vein accessed (subclavian, axillary, innominate, etc.) and the device type, since the device value in the code depends on whether it is a port, PICC, tunneled catheter, or non-tunneled catheter.
A frequent error is coding the vein where the device physically sits versus the vein through which it was threaded to reach a central location; PCS conventions direct coders to the vessel entered, not the final tip position. Another common miss is failing to capture a separate approach or an additional procedure, such as fluoroscopic guidance, when institutional policy requires it. Missing device-type documentation - port versus catheter versus infusion device - also leads to query generation, since the seventh-character device value cannot be guessed.
Commonly Confused With
Insertion is often confused with Administration procedures, which cover injecting a substance rather than placing hardware; a one-time IV push of contrast or medication is not coded here. It is also distinct from Revision, which applies when an existing device is being corrected or repositioned rather than placed for the first time, and from Removal, which is used only when the device is taken out with no replacement. Central line placement can additionally be confused with Lower Veins insertion when the catheter is threaded from a femoral approach - the body system reflects the vein actually entered, not the vein where the tip ultimately rests.
